A Help authoring tool or HAT is a software program used by technical writers to create online Help.
Some common Help authoring tools include:
- Adobe FrameMaker: The most common tool for large technical documents.
- Macromedia RoboHelp: A specialized tool for creating online help.
- Microsoft Word: Widely used for technical writing despite its limitations.
- Epic Editor: An XML-based authoring tool.
- Microsoft Visio: Software for creating diagrams.
- Webworks Publisher: Converts documents in various formats to other formats, primarily HTML.
Technical writers also use content management systems and version control systems to manage their work.
